    Whenever I try to add a Google Maps embed for an event, the embed box appears blank. I am using an active and functional Maps Embed API key. I have also copied the address for the venue as displayed on Google Maps and I am still presented with a blank box for the maps. This has been a running issue with this plugin for months and I am displeased that nothing has been done to correct it. Could you please investigate as to why the Maps Embed is not functioning.

    Note: I am using Version 4.6.23 of The Events Calendar and the latest version of WordPress.

    I’m unable to view your site since it’s in maintenance mode. This is likely due to the Google Maps API key not being correctly set up.

    Google recently rolled out changes that deny keyless APIs.

    Here’s their new guide for obtaining an API key → https://developers.google.com/maps/documentation/javascript/get-api-key
